Excellent trail with challenging terrain. It has difficult climbs as well as gradual rolling sections. Part of the system is lit from 4:30 to 9:30 all winter. Located adjacent to Cloquet area recreation center (hockey rink), south of Pine Tree Plaza.

I recommend parking on Spring Lake Drive and skiing the back loop only (if you do that, you could get away with using B skis). It’s in good condition, with only a scattering of debris and a few small bare spots. The classic tracks are fairly eroded, but the skate deck is fairly soft, not hardpan. Pine Valley lives up to its name on the front loop. It’s carpeted in pine debris and basically unskiable. Also, walkerrs on the front loop of the trail and left deep holes - apparently those walkers didn't get to the back loop, so there’s no footprints there. There is a lot of debris under the pines. Classic tracks are shallow and washed out in places. Skate deck is hard, but skaters should fare better than classic skiers. Needs grooming.

Nicely groomed and tracked. A lot of debris in the classic track, especially under the evergreens on the front or lighted loop. The back loop is better, but still has some debris. Grooming has been very good, but we need new snow for the classic track. Skate deck looks very good.
